SUMMARY OF POSITION RESPONSIBILITIES:  

Responsible for being knowledgeable on the capabilities of the Symitar system in regards to PowerOn programming, standard batch programming options, forms and Episys parameter settings. This position is responsible for the design, development and implementation of application development projects and system maintenance efforts. Work involves working on multiple high-level projects concurrently. Resources to do the job require reliance on technical knowledge of programming concepts, architecture and process enhancement. Direction is received from the IT Manager  & VP of Information Technology.

  • Responsible for full life cycle development including design, implementation, testing and maintenance of beginner to intermediate PowerOn programs and subsystems. Writes efficient code that follows credit union defined standards and naming conventions.
  • Conducts detailed analysis of system interactions to determine technical solutions and resolves problems which are cost effective and consistent with user needs, system capacities and capabilities.
  • Works with other departments and/or vendors on project development. Attends meetings with appropriate employees or vendors to obtain necessary information and direction to proceed with the development and success of the project.
  • Modifies existing software to meet branch and/or department employee’s requirements. Maintains and modifies code that is in production to comply with system changes and new CU specifications. Debugs existing code to ensure minimal user downtime and maintain maximum member service.
  • Utilizes effective project management techniques in planning, estimating, controlling and completing assignments
  • Works with IT team to troubleshoot complex problems to identify if code related.
  • Performs other duties as assigned. (including help desk support to all internal team members)
